Why Budget Folding Electric Bikes Usually Fall Short

Before diving into specs, let’s talk about the market reality.

Many sub-$1000 folding ebikes come with:

  • 350W motors

  • 10Ah batteries

  • Narrow tires

  • Limited hill-climbing torque

  • Basic mechanical brakes

They look good on paper but struggle in real-world riding — especially if you:

  • Live in a hilly area

  • Weigh over 180 lbs

  • Commute longer than 10 miles

  • Want stable handling at 25+ mph

To stand out, a folding electric bike must balance power, battery capacity, and frame stability — not just price.

Battery & Range: 48V 13.5Ah (648Wh) Explained

Battery size determines whether your e-bike feels freeing — or limiting.

Hunter includes a 48V 13.5Ah removable lithium battery, totaling 648Wh.

What Does 648Wh Mean?

In practical terms:

  • Up to 65 miles on pedal assist

  • 30–45 miles on mixed throttle use

  • Suitable for full-week commuting without daily charging

Many competitors in the same price category only offer 480Wh–500Wh batteries.

That extra capacity matters.

If you’re specifically searching for a long range folding ebike, battery size should be your top priority — and Hunter delivers above average for its price class.
